With the rapid development of China’s digital economy, tax authorities are gradually shifting the tax administrative model from ex-ante approval to ex-post management. The adoption of new technology tools not only enables taxpayers to deal with tax matters online, it also empowers tax authorities to identify tax risks more accurately through big data analysis.
